How to Beat All Monsters in E.R.P.O.
New monsters are continually introduced to E.R.P.O., making it essential to keep this guide bookmarked for the latest updates. Below, you'll find detailed strategies for each monster, along with general combat methods:
Melee Combat: Equip yourself with melee weapons like the Machete or Hammer, available for purchase in the shop ranging from 10k to 20k cash. These will appear in your next level, ready for you to pick up with M1 and use against monsters. Adopt a hit-and-run strategy to minimize damage, especially against ranged attackers like the Huntsman. Always carry healing packs for safety.
Grenades and Mines: These explosives, also available in the shop, can be game-changers. Pick up a Grenade with M1, remove the pin with E, and throw it or set it down to lure monsters into its blast radius. Mines require placement and patience; once a monster steps on one, it's a guaranteed hit. Both are effective against weaker and even some tougher monsters.
Monster Brawl: Use the environment to your advantage. Lure a Huntsman into shooting another monster by hiding behind it and making noise. Similarly, pull Reapers into each other during their attack animations to cause mutual damage.
Robe Guide (Ghost)

The Robe, a shadowy figure, can be deadly upon contact. Evade it by crouching and hiding, or keep it at a distance by kiting. It's best to take it down with two Grenades or Mines, as melee combat is risky due to its high damage output. Be aware that Robe teleports and accelerates toward you if you stare at its mask.
Reaper Guide

The Reaper, a doll-like creature with spinning sword arms, is less dangerous than Robe in melee combat. Kite or avoid it, as it doesn't teleport. It's vulnerable to melee attacks and can be defeated with one Grenade and a few hits. Grenades and Mines also stun it, making follow-up attacks easier.
Apex Predator Guide (Duck)

These seemingly harmless ducks turn hostile if you interact with them aggressively. Once provoked, they relentlessly pursue you, dealing low damage. Outrun them or use melee weapons to dispatch them quickly. Grenades are an overkill for these low-HP creatures.
Huntsman

The Huntsman, a blind gunman with a deadly aim, relies on sound to locate you. Stay silent by crouching and hiding beneath tables to avoid detection. Avoid melee confrontations due to its one-shot capability. Instead, strategically place Mines or throw Grenades while crouched to stun it for six seconds, providing an opportunity for a melee attack.
